Lady Gaga Backstage September 2011
Singer Lady Gaga poses backstage in a Moschino black crepe dress with waist ruffle and bow detail at the iHeartRadio Music Festival held at the MGM Grand Garden Arena on September 24, 2011 in Las Vegas, Nevada.
Usher with David Guetta September 2012
Singer USHER poses with David Guetta backstage in a Moschino black and white leather jacket at the iHeartRadio Music Festival held at the MGM Grand Garden Arena on September 24, 2011 in Las Vegas, Nevada.

Boston Proper Part of Chico’s
Chico’s FAS, Inc. announced September 20, 2011 that it has successfully completed the acquisition of Boston Proper, a Boca Raton, Florida based direct-to-consumer retailer of distinctive women’s apparel and accessories. Uzbek Cotton Being Boycott by Global Clothing Brands
More than 60 of the world’s top clothing labels, including Burberry and Levi, are to boycott cotton from Uzbekistan over claims the government forces children to harvest the crop. Swedish high street retailer H&M, and sportswear companies Adidas and Puma … Continue reading
Is China Losing Edge as Low Cost Manufacturer
China may be losing its edge as the world’s cheapest place to manufacture goods, a new report suggests. The report by consultants KPMG says that minimum wage levels in China are now four times greater than other places in South and South … Continue reading
